BMW should stay NA due to reliability and driveability.
If they do go the forced induction route, PLEASE make it turbos and not superchargers. Those roots style blowers that Mercedes are using are WEAK on the top end, and require a good amount of HP to run (less efficient).
I would much rather see some low boost Turbos on top of the already great BMW enginers than a noisy inefficient blower.

AMG Supercharged vehicles do not use roots type they use the
new Lyscholm type (helical supercharger) from IHI normally
running about 15Psi of boost they are strong as crazy !!!!
My little V6 Gets me 298 HP at the wheel and 287 Torque !!!
